INTERNAL MEMO — To the Board

Subject: Marketing budget reduction

Effective next quarter, the marketing budget is reduced by 18%. The cut falls primarily on trade-show presence and the Lanternfield print campaign; digital spend is largely preserved. Headcount is unaffected. The reduction reflects the reallocation agreed at the autumn planning session and keeps us within the revised operating envelope. Department plans will be resubmitted within three weeks. A confidential note on the underlying business direction follows below.

board note of tadup-tajog: Headcount on the Oliiel team goes from 31 to 88 by the end of February. Gross margin on Oliiel came in at 62 percent against a plan of 29 percent.

## Releases

Vettle ships two client SDKs: vettle-js and vettle-kt. A release is blocked until both pass the parity matrix in sdk/parity.yaml — every public method must exist in both, with matching defaults. Reviewers: diff the generated API surface files, not the source. Known gaps go in PARITY_EXCEPTIONS.md with an expiry date. Tagged releases must be signed with the key below.

rollout seal: bky4_x7Gc

Handover — turnstile works, Bellhaven Tower

Night shift: east lobby turnstiles are being swapped out by Gatewell this week. Lanes 1–2 offline until Thursday. Route everyone through lane 3. Contractors finish by 05:00; check they've signed out. Barrier gate stays locked otherwise. If you need to open the accessible gate for the fit-out crew, use this code:

door code, yagap-bahof: bdg-O-05